On Saturday, Feb. 8, former Jasper High School standout JB Landrum’s current college team, the Huntingdon Hawks, lost 8-7 in their NCAA Division III baseball game against the Rhodes Lynx.

The game took place at Shehee Stadium. This was their first matchup against the Lynx this season.

The Hawks’ next game is scheduled for Sunday, Feb. 23 at 4:30 p.m. at Neal Posey Field against Emory Eagles.
